In 2021, Enex Luxembourg deployed farmerswife Real-Time Facility Scheduling as a cloud-hosted timeline to support distributed newsgathering operations. The deployment addressed Facility Management needs for centralized resource scheduling, equipment availability, and booking configuration to enable more maintainable, remote-friendly operations during COVID. Configuration work focused on timeline-driven resource scheduling, equipment and satellite booking configuration, and API integration points. farmerswife Real-Time Facility Scheduling was configured to expose scheduling and booking endpoints, and inferred module usage emphasized timeline management, resource calendars, and reservation controls aligned with broadcasting production workflows. The engagement began in 2021 with extensive API testing and collaboration between Enex teams and the vendor, and the implementation went live in 2022 per the published case study. The cloud-hosted farmerswife timeline enabled API-driven integrations to support remote production tooling and distributed operations across Enex newsgathering functions without specifying additional third party systems. Governance and rollout emphasized iterative API validation and configuration handoffs to operational staff, shifting scheduling ownership into the platform and streamlining booking processes for equipment and satellite resources. Outcomes explicitly reported include improved remote operations during COVID and a more maintainable cloud setup for ongoing Facility Management of broadcast resources.

Enex Luxembourg is a Media organization based in Luxembourg, with around 30 employees and annual revenues of $5.0 million.

Enex Luxembourg operates a diverse technology stack with applications such as farmerswife Real-Time Facility Scheduling, OpenAI GPT-4 and Workplace by Facebook, covering areas like Facility Management, Generative AI Platforms and Collaboration.
